Attend "Behavioral Assessment I" in July


If you are responsible for interviewing and assessing discerners, learn how to master these skills from one of the top experts in the country: Father Raymond P. Carey, Ph.D.  He will present the NRVC workshop "Behavioral Assessment 1" July 10-12 in Chicago as part of NRVC's Summer Institute.

This  workshop will focus on initial assessment of candidates, but the methodology easily applies to assessing candidates in other stages of formation as well. Participants will study sample case reports,  learn skills for interviewing, and understand guidelines for organizing the information into useful reports. Interview topics include: family background, educational and occupational histories, psychosexual histories and intimacy skills, faith history, etc.

"The most helpful part . . . was real answers to real needs. My sense is that finally I have something to apply to the issues I struggle with in assessing candidates," said Sister Mary Ana Steele, O.S.F., a past participant in this workshop.

Father Carey is a clinical psychologist and priest of the Archdiocese of Seattle who has taught assessment skills to vocation ministers for more than 15 years. For details or to register for the workshop, click here.
